Exactly How You Can Benefit From Selling Your Backyard In Mckinnon

Carving up and selling the backyard has ended up being a progressively typical scenario in Mckinnon. And it’s not simply occurring in suburban areas such as Glen Waverley with its big blocks. Inner city areas such as Brunswick and Northcote are also seeing backyard developments in often impossibly small areas.

However such developments are no get-rich-quick scheme. Subdivision approvals can take 6 months-2 years to get approval through council. Every council has its own guidelines and regulations relating to backyard subdivision. Many state a minimum land size and need a percentage of land to be private open space. A subdivided block normally needs car to gain access to along with the existing home and at least one car spot for each two-bedroom residence (2 for three bed rooms).

An ideal residential or home for subdivision has the existing residence near the front border and a lot of side area. Corner blocks make for easier vehicle access and have actually the added advantage of giving the new dwelling a street frontage.

Subdividing Land And Building A Unit In The Backyard

What impact does subdividing have on the worth of the existing residential or home? Carving off a piece of land will naturally lower the worth of exactly what’s left. However the correlation is not uncomplicated. What you’ve done is alter the market for the front home.

It will not attract households looking for a big house and huge backyard to match, for instance, but it might appeal more to individuals who like that place which design of home but don’t care for a big backyard with all the upkeep that needs.

According to some real estate representatives, there is plenty of demand for homes without yards, especially in inner suburban areas. Some people like the location and they like the duration style of the house on the block

So they are happy to do without a backyard, however they will expect a discount rate.

The Best Ways Subdivide

With so much money at stake, there is very little space for error. Fortunately, it has ended up being a lot simpler to find out information about a residential or, most likely resale prices, and what other subdivided blocks are selling for in your location.

There are 2 ways most mum-and-dad property developers subdivide: they either remain in their home and develop one residential or out the back or they knock the home down, move out and develop three (or four if the block huge enough) townhouses on the block.

Among the benefits of remaining in your house is that you don’t have the extra holding expenses of the home loan while you wait to develop both houses. Which is why it is so essential to get an idea of what does it cost? the residential or, or residential or , will sell for.

Over-estimating the sale price at the end is the No. 1 mistake people make. Always remember that when you build in your backyard, the worth of your initial house will decrease along with its lot size.”

The Right Block

Zoning: Depending upon the zoning of the residential or , the land may or may not have the ability to be subdivided. Contact your regional council.

Land size: Typically, the land size ought to be at least 700sq m of “usable land” to satisfy local council guidelines, but this varies from one state to another.

Land design: Preferably, the home must have a great design with adequate area to install a driveway that’s 2.5 m to 3.5 m wide.

Land slope: A reasonably flat block of land is simpler and cheaper to work with for a subdivision project.
